My first "real" table was a Dual 1215S that I bought new in 1972 or 1973.
It was a workhorse that lasted me until 1989 or so. I just always liked the wood look. Plus you could also play the occasional 78 on it with a quick stylus change. Oh and I almost forgot,cleaning the records with my trusty
discwasher D4 system was a snap because of the strong idler drive.
Dean,I believe that the 1229 is also an idler not a belt drive.
